A New era of practical insurance and reinsurance training
The South African insurance and reinsurance sectors have long grappled with a void in structured, consistent, and practically focused professional development.
This gap has only widened since the COVID-19 pandemic disrupted in-person learning and caused many established institutions to shut down their training operations indefinitely. Recognising this critical shortfall and driven by a deep commitment to rebuilding and uplifting the industry’s technical capacity, The Oak Tree Academy was born.

Why The Oak Tree Academy?
The idea for the academy was sparked by a clear need: the insurance and reinsurance industry has suffered from a lack of high-quality, relevant training options. Weekly sessions that used to bring professionals together to sharpen their skills and share experiences have all but disappeared. The Oak Tree Academy seeks to fill that void, offering something that many other institutions have overlooked: practical, real-world training tailored to the African insurance landscape.

What makes Oak Tree Academy different?
- Practical learning approach: Courses are designed to give participants hands-on, applicable knowledge that they can immediately use in their daily work.
- Industry experts as trainers: Every course is developed and delivered in collaboration with seasoned professionals, ensuring that content reflects current realities and best practices.
- CPD accreditation focus: All content will be submitted to the Insurance Institute of South Africa (IISA) for CPD accreditation, ensuring that learners receive recognised professional development hours.
- Hybrid delivery: Training will be delivered in-person at a custom-built, state-of-the-art facility, as well as online to accommodate broader participation.

Facilities and delivery
The Oak Tree Academy training hub is located at Unit 6, Boss Crane Office Park. The newly built training room, designed to accommodate a maximum of 16 attendees per session, is purposefully kept small to foster deep interaction, group discussion, and personal engagement.
However, recognising the importance of accessibility and scale, select sessions will also be available online. This ensures that learners from across the country, and eventually the continent, can benefit from the same high-quality training.
Each course will be developed with both digital and in-person presentation in mind.
